The undeniable value in used meat mixers

At first glance, the idea of purchasing used butcher machines might seem counter-intuitive. The instinctive assumption is that used equates to lower quality, but this is not always the case. In reality, used meat mixers often represent an opportunity to get high-quality equipment at a fraction of the original cost.

Restaurants, caterers, and butchers frequently update their equipment, meaning their previous machines – many still in prime condition – end up on the used market. This is where astute buyers can find excellent deals, gaining access to top-tier equipment that might otherwise be out of their financial reach. In essence, purchasing used allows you to elevate the quality of your equipment without having to stretch your budget beyond comfort. What to watch out for when buying used butcher machines

Of course, while there are many benefits to buying used, there are potential pitfalls to navigate. When considering a used meat mixer, it’s important to check for signs of excessive wear and tear, corrosion, and functionality issues. Always ask for a demonstration before purchase, if possible.

Understanding the machine’s history is also important. Knowing how frequently it was used and for what purposes can provide insights into its current condition. Was it used daily in a busy butcher shop, or only occasionally in a small restaurant? The difference could significantly impact the longevity of your purchase.

Lastly, consider the availability of spare parts. Older models may have parts that are hard to find or discontinued, which could cause headaches down the line if repairs are needed. Do your homework and ensure you’re making a savvy purchase.

Finding the balance: when does buying used make sense?

The truth is, buying used butcher machines isn’t always the best choice. It ultimately depends on your unique circumstances, including your budget, needs, and capacity for potential repairs. Buying used makes excellent sense when you need high-quality equipment but have budget constraints. It’s also a smart move if you’re looking to reduce waste and contribute to a circular economy.

However, if your operation relies heavily on your meat mixer and downtime could cost you significantly, buying new with a warranty might be the safer bet. The same goes if you’re not comfortable dealing with potential repairs or can’t find the spare parts you need.

The key is to balance the pros and cons and make an informed decision.
